Lady’s Tower with North Berwick Law (a volcanic plug that resisted the scraping glaciers of the ice age) across the Firth of Forth. The folly was built in the 1770s as a summerhouse and bathing house for Janet Fall, Lady Anstruther, wife of the laird of Ardross & Elie estate. Lady Anstruther is said to have enjoyed sea-bathing and sent a bell-ringer around Elie to warn the local people to keep away, to protect her modesty. Elie, Fife, Scotland.

East Vows Beacon, Elie, Fife, Scotland. Constructed in 1847 by Alan Stevenson, the cage was intended as a refuge for shipwrecked mariners.

WWII searchlight building with faceted roof for aerial camouflage, Kincraig Battery, Elie, Fife, Scotland.
